What companies run services between Matzen, Lower Austria and Vienna, Austria?

There is no direct connection from Matzen to Vienna. However, you can take the line 530 bus to Gänserndorf Bahnhof Z, walk to Gaenserndorf, then take the train to Wien Mitte. Alternatively, you can take a bus from Matzen Schule to Wien Mitte via Wolkersdorf Bahnhof and Wolkersdorf Im Weinviertel in around 1h 11m.
